BTCPay Server warned Friday that attackers are exploiting a critical vulnerability that could lead to stolen funds. Administrators must immediately install version 2.4.2 or shut down their servers to prevent unauthorized access. The flaw affects macaroon credentials and hot wallet funds. The project did not disclose how the vulnerability works, when the attacks began, or how much funds were potentially stolen. The project also did not confirm whether AI was involved in finding this vulnerability.
